**Ticket: Turnstile counter double-counts at Gate C**

Hey — the Marlow Field turnstile service increments twice when someone badges in and the sensor re-fires within 200ms. Pretty sure the debounce window got dropped in the last refactor of the Tallygate handler. Fix restores the window and adds a test. Repro'd on the staging rig running the build with the token below.

session token of tajef-bageg = htk21_5d90d574934f3ccae6437

Subject: Quickstore 4.2 — bloom filter now fronts the KV layer

Plugin authors: starting with this release, Quickstore places a bloom filter ahead of the key-value store. Negative lookups return faster; false positives fall through safely. No API changes are required on your side. Verify your plugin against the staging build referenced below.

session token of fahif-tadup = htk3_9c7

Ticket #977 — Echohall audio-guide env misconfigured

Prod build of the Echohall museum guide app points at the sandbox narration CDN, so galleries play placeholder audio. Fix: in the release env file, set NARRATION_CDN=prod and AUDIO_CACHE_TTL=3600. The prod CDN rejects unsigned requests, so the env file must also carry the CDN signing secret. Add it on the next line.

sealed setting: ARCHIVE_KEY3=8d0

MEMO — Finance Team

Effective next quarter, Brellan Instruments will revise the sales-commission scheme. Base commission drops to 4%, with a 2% accelerator once reps exceed quota on the Veltrix product line. Clawbacks now apply to cancellations within 90 days. Please update payout models and brief regional controllers by Friday. The context for this change is set out below.

confidential, bahap-bajog: Zorethix Works is in early talks to buy Kelethox Foods for about $30.7 million. The Ralvan launch date is September 19, and nothing goes to the press before then.

- [ ] **Step 7: Breaker override escrow.** After sealing the signing keys for the Tallgrove upstream API circuit breaker, confirm the support team can force the breaker open during a full outage. The override bundle lives in the sealed escrow drawer and is useless without its unlock phrase. Two ceremony witnesses must initial this step before proceeding. The escrow bundle is decrypted with the recovery passphrase that follows.

vault phrase of kahip-kahop = holath-quenmir